tirn technology Announces Christoph Gümbel as Its First Advisor to shape Its Product And the Direction of the Company 

Slovakia, Trnava | 03.04.2022tirn technology announces Christoph Gümbel as its first advisor to shape its product and the direction of the company.

With over 35 years of experience working for Porsche AG, Christoph is widely regarded as one of the leading minds in digital prototyping and applied simulation methods for design and functional verification in the vehicle development process.

Furthermore, Christoph was the driving force in the start-up of three enterprises in Germany and abroad. These companies are successfully working in the areas of high-performance computing, computer-aided engineering, and methods for numerical simulation to this day.

Journey to zero-emission future is full of adventures and gives you chances to work with great people such as Christoph, who has just become our first advisor at tirn technology. I am enormously proud to have him on board, as it is a great recognition of the work we’ve done so far.  In addition, Christoph brings vast experience in automotive, virtual vehicle development, and simulations.”

– Juraj Majera (CEO of tirn technology)

 

About tirn technology

The adoption of electric buses across municipalities around the world is not happening fast enough. We would love to change that!

Our vision at tirn technology is to create an easy and ready-to-use simulation software for collaboration between operators and manufacturers by using the current possibilities of A.I., publicly available relevant data, and modern simulation models to shape the future of electric mobility faster. 

Our platform zero-emission bus (ZEB) simulator identifies the optimal bus model, powertrain energy storage technology, the charging infrastructure, and its requirements. This provides the users with better predictions of the total cost of ownership and CO2 reduction.
